2009-07-27 6 views
2

Je ne sais pas comment faire cette tâche.en utilisant la méthode getpath() je peux obtenir le chemin de la base de données. Dans l'émulateur de terminal en utilisant commends je peux voir le fichier de base de données contenant les requêtes ce que j'ai exécuté est enregistré dans la mémoire de l'émulateur.Comment puis-je accéder à ce fichier à partir d'une application android.Est-ce possible.please m'aider.Comment puis-je accéder aux fichiers de données appartient à une application sous Android?

+0

Est-ce une base de données que vous avez créé sur la carte SD ou une base de données interne? –

+0

J'ai créé en tant que base de données interne – Rajapandian

Répondre

2

Vous pouvez obtenir getContext(). OpenFileInput() pour obtenir les fichiers créés par/pour l'application en cours. ces fichiers sont dans /data/data/com.you.application/ et ont l'UID/GID lié à l'application pour des raisons de sécurité

Questions connexes